1 I have shorewall set up on my router but I haven't set up anything
2 security-wise for my laptop which normally sits behind the router.
3 What should I be setting up on the laptop in preparation for traveling
4 and connecting via a foreign network or even directly to the Internet?
5 I don't run sshd on the laptop. I would think shorewall, but am I
6 forgetting anything?
